Night Sky Exposures - Stefan Lieberman, Germany | With clearer night time skies, Stefan Lieberman shares his tips on how less pollution can help your night time photography:
Stefan shoots on a Sony a7S & r Sony a7 III
As a night sky photographer, I'm active when it's darkest. I mostly work alone and rarely encounter people. Because of this, very little immediately changed for me. But I could see the difference in the sky.
The most critical thing for my work is avoiding light pollution. Too much light drowns out the sky. But the current situation means there's less traffic on roads, and ambient light from businesses has decreased. All in all, light pollution has noticeably reduced.
While we wait for the world to return to normal, we've all got a rare opportunity to get out and capture the sky with less interference. Travel restrictions may mean I'm staying local, but I've been able to capture beautiful shots while exploring the Thuringian Forest in Germany.
When it comes to making the most of the reduced light pollution, Stefan outlines the key elements:
First, it is important to avoid bright light sources. There are currently fewer, but it's still best if you're away from a city. Next, you'll need to use a tripod to keep the shot steady. Finally, you'll need to experiment with setting long exposures, and ideally trigger it with an external shutter release.
In addition, this sort of photography can benefit from a good understanding of post-processing techniques, such as stitching shots together. Now is a great chance to spend time learning about these.
Macro Photography - Petar Sabol, Croatia | While we've less space to roam, Petar Sabol talks us through capturing the beauty of smaller things, with macro photography:
Petar shoots on a Sony a7R IV
Where I live, I have been unable to leave my village. While that might normally limit me, macro photography focuses on small subjects. It's the perfect art to practice when you're confined, because any space is full of tiny details to capture.
I think that this period has given us all the chance to take a second look at the familiar. Over the years I've trained my eye to search for the beauty in the small details. But even I am finding that I'm noticing things that I'd normally pass by.
My focus lies on wildlife, with insects in particular, and this time has given me the chance to really learn the habits of local creatures. I'm able to get up early, when it's cold and quiet, and the insects are still sleeping. That's when they're most still, and I can capture the best shots.
I'm interested in insects, but therell be something small and close to home for everyone to capture. The textures, the abstract details we normally ignore. The possibilities are limitless.
To capture great macro shots, Petar suggests:
This is a time to improve skills indoors. Take ordinary items and use them as your focus, whether it's sugar or a kitchen utensil. Find the detail worth observing in things we use every day, but don't normally pay attention to. Make sure you're learning how to light small subjects to capture all the details.
If you've got a garden, or even just an outdoor space, look for the insects! Get out early when it's cold and they're still. Get down low and on their level but be sure to respect their space and not damage their environment while you're photographing them.
Macro photography takes patience and practice. But now is the best time to learn or perfect the art, because a lot of us have a bit more spare time.
Wildlife Photography - Will Burrard Lucas, UK | Having gone from shooting in Africa to home in the UK, Will Burrard Lucas talks us through how best to capture wildlife in your immediate surroundings:
Will shoots on a Sony a7R IV
Last year, I was photographing a rare black panther in Kenya. I was finishing this up, and planning to collect my cameras, when the coronavirus struck. Things are definitely different now, but it doesnt mean I haven't kept busy.
Having time to experiment with techniques and practice with your camera is a good opportunity to improve your photography. I've been setting up camera traps in the garden, and they're perfect for getting intimate images of shy garden wildlife. While I might not have any panthers around, there are many similarities between photographing wild animals and our household pets.
Not to mention, now I have time to catch up on all of the office tasks I had previously put off; I'm laying foundations so that when this is over I will emerge in a better position to be able to concentrate on my photography.
